Ever wondered why Skyler White, the often-maligned wife of Walter White in "Breaking Bad," has become such a potent cultural touchstone? The answer lies in her complex portrayal, the audience's shifting perceptions, and the enduring power of meme culture to reshape our understanding of television characters.

Skyler White, a character brought to life by the talented Anna Gunn, is far more than just the nagging wife. She's a woman navigating a world of increasingly difficult choices, grappling with the disintegration of her marriage and the shocking transformation of her husband. This is the crux of her narrative arc, a journey fraught with moral compromises and emotional turmoil.

The genesis of her meme-ified presence traces back to the early episodes of "Breaking Bad." Specifically, in Season 1, Episode 2, titled "Cat's in the Bag", Skyler confronts Jesse Pinkman, portrayed by Aaron Paul, about selling marijuana to Walter. In this crucial scene, she remains oblivious to the much darker, more dangerous reality unfolding just beyond her awareness the meth enterprise and the grisly discovery in the yard. It's a juxtaposition of ignorance and denial that's ripe for comedic interpretation, a seed that would later sprout into a viral phenomenon.

The show's creators, particularly Vince Gilligan, masterfully crafted Skyler White. They provided viewers with a character who embodies many of the traits that audiences often find objectionable in television wives and mothers. Her initial concerns regarding Walter's actions are often perceived as nagging, her attempts to control situations are interpreted as meddling, and her focus on maintaining appearances is seen as shallow. All these qualities make her a natural target for online criticism and the subject of memes.

The memeification of Skyler White is deeply intertwined with the social media landscape. This offers platforms for fans to share their creativity, their interpretations, and their often-pointed critiques.

The meme culture surrounding Skyler goes beyond simple mockery; it reveals a complex interplay of factors, ranging from the perceived hypocrisy of the character to the way audiences interpret the narrative. As the show progressed, Skyler's actions, driven by her need to protect her family and survive in an increasingly dangerous world, frequently sparked intense debate. This created a fertile ground for memes that highlighted the more contentious aspects of her behavior.

The popularity of these memes points towards the cultural significance of "Breaking Bad." The series, with its intricate plotlines and flawed characters, fosters deep engagement from viewers. Characters like Skyler ignite lively discussions and, more importantly, spark memes, GIFs, and humorous images.

The internet's capacity for quick, widespread sharing allows these memes to reach a global audience almost instantly. This is especially true for platforms like TikTok, where a scene from Season 1 has become a wholesome meme. This demonstrates the enduring influence of the show, its ability to generate new content years after the finale aired, and the way its woven into the fabric of online culture. A simple sound clip can launch a viral trend, showcasing the impact of a well-crafted scene, even years after its initial airing.

The meme phenomenon also highlights the importance of context. Memes distill complex characters and narratives into simple, shareable formats, and this can sometimes lead to the simplification of character motivations or the misrepresentation of actions. While memes can be humorous and offer a form of shared cultural experience, they may not always reflect a full understanding of the character's journey.
